The Conversion Formula
Converting pounds to kilograms involves a simple mathematical formula. The conversion factor is approximately 0.45359237. To convert pounds to kilograms, you multiply the weight in pounds by this factor. For example, to convert 158Lbs In Kg, you would use the following formula:
Weight in kg = Weight in lbs × 0.45359237
Let's apply this formula to 158Lbs In Kg:
158 lbs × 0.45359237 = 71.66 kg
So, 158Lbs In Kg is approximately 71.66 kilograms.

Common Weight Conversions
Here are some common weight conversions that you might find useful:
| Pounds (lbs) | Kilograms (kg) |
|---|---|
| 100 | 45.36 |
| 120 | 54.43 |
| 140 | 63.50 |
| 158 | 71.66 |
| 160 | 72.57 |
| 180 | 81.65 |
| 200 | 90.72 |
These conversions can be handy for quick reference when you need to switch between pounds and kilograms.
